From: Souptick Joarder Date: Fri, 26 Oct 2018 22:04:03 +0000 (-0700) Subject: mm: convert to use vm_fault_t X-Git-Tag: v5.15~7719^2~103 X-Git-Url: http://review.tizen.org/git/?a=commitdiff_plain;h=4b96a37d1c684f12468f436c0d79b5e6830d0b0b;p=platform%2Fkernel%2Flinux-starfive.git mm: convert to use vm_fault_t As part of vm_fault_t conversion filemap_page_mkwrite() for the NOMMU case was missed. Now converted. Link: http://lkml.kernel.org/r/20180828174952.GA29229@jordon-HP-15-Notebook-PC Signed-off-by: Souptick Joarder Reviewed-by: Andrew Morton Cc: Matthew Wilcox Signed-off-by: Andrew Morton Signed-off-by: Linus Torvalds --- diff --git a/mm/filemap.c b/mm/filemap.c index 52517f2..de6fed2 100644 --- a/mm/filemap.c +++ b/mm/filemap.c @@ -2748,9 +2748,9 @@ int generic_file_readonly_mmap(struct file *file, struct vm_area_struct *vma) return generic_file_mmap(file, vma); } #else -int filemap_page_mkwrite(struct vm_fault *vmf) +vm_fault_t filemap_page_mkwrite(struct vm_fault *vmf) { - return -ENOSYS; + return VM_FAULT_SIGBUS; } int generic_file_mmap(struct file * file, struct vm_area_struct * vma) {